1. Ignoring Mobile Optimization
With mobile devices accounting for over half of global web traffic, neglecting mobile optimization can be detrimental. Ensure your website is responsive and loads quickly on all devices.
2. Overlooking Local SEO
For businesses targeting local customers, failing to optimize for local SEO can lead to missed opportunities. Claim your Google My Business listing and encourage customer reviews to enhance local visibility.
3. Poor Keyword Research
Using outdated or irrelevant keywords can hinder your SEO efforts. Invest time in thorough keyword research to identify terms that resonate with your target audience.
4. Neglecting Content Quality
Content is king, but only if it’s high-quality. Avoid thin content and focus on creating informative, engaging articles that provide real value to your readers.
5. Not Updating Old Content
Old content can become stale and irrelevant. Regularly update your existing articles to keep them fresh and aligned with current trends and information.
6. Ignoring Technical SEO
Technical issues like slow loading times, broken links, and improper use of tags can severely impact your rankings. Conduct regular technical audits to identify and fix these problems.
7. Failing to Optimize Meta Tags
Meta titles and descriptions are crucial for click-through rates. Ensure they are compelling and include relevant keywords to attract more visitors.
8. Not Utilizing Analytics
Analytics tools provide valuable insights into user behavior. Regularly review your analytics to understand what’s working and what needs improvement.
9. Duplicate Content Issues
Duplicate content can confuse search engines and dilute your rankings. Use canonical tags to indicate the preferred version of your content.
10. Neglecting User Experience (UX)
A poor user experience can lead to high bounce rates. Focus on creating a seamless navigation experience and ensure your website is visually appealing.
11. Ignoring Backlink Quality
Not all backlinks are created equal. Focus on acquiring high-quality backlinks from reputable sources to improve your domain authority.
12. Failing to Leverage Social Media
Social media can drive traffic and enhance your SEO efforts. Share your content across platforms to increase visibility and engagement.
13. Not Adapting to Algorithm Changes
Search engines frequently update their algorithms. Stay informed about these changes and adjust your strategies accordingly to maintain your rankings.
14. Lack of Clear Calls to Action (CTAs)
Without clear CTAs, users may not know what to do next. Incorporate effective CTAs to guide visitors toward desired actions, such as signing up or making a purchase.
15. Underestimating the Power of Video Content
Video content is increasingly favored by search engines. Incorporate videos into your strategy to enhance engagement and improve rankings.

How can I recover from an SEO penalty?
To recover from an SEO penalty, identify the cause, rectify the issues, and submit a reconsideration request to Google.
